Output 51f758849ff5169576fe5385504b0833f67332b90c260c222219024d78b3f141:2

value
643
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 563d6ae3e320bebaf765d99af54d800aedb6b40458c560c2c00bde51d2234fb3
address
bc1p2c7k4clryzlt4am9mxd02nvqptkmddqytrzkpskqp009r53rf7eseffr3e
transaction
51f758849ff5169576fe5385504b0833f67332b90c260c222219024d78b3f141
spent
true